Supercritical circulating fluidized bed units are widely used due to their wide adaptability to coal types and stable combustion characteristics.The article takes a 350 MW supercritical circulating fluidized bed unit in a certain power plant as an example to conduct in-depth research on energy conservation and consumption reduction during the unit start-up process.Through measures such as selecting bed material particle size and bed pressure,controlling ignition air volume,and on-site heating,energy conservation and consumption reduction during the unit start-up process have been achieved,in order to provide reference for the optimized operation of similar units.
